Grayscale has released a detailed report outlining the essential steps for blockchain networks to transition to quantum-resistant cryptography. The source reports that this initiative is crucial as the industry prepares for potential threats posed by quantum computing.
Structured Approach to Enhanced Security Measures
The report emphasizes a structured approach that includes several key phases:
- algorithm standardization
- protocol development
- rigorous testing
- community engagement
- the establishment of grace periods for implementing transitional mechanisms
These steps are designed to facilitate a smooth shift towards enhanced security measures.
Hybrid Systems and Quantum Resistance
Notably, the report reveals that several major blockchain projects are already experimenting with hybrid systems that integrate quantum-resistant features. This proactive strategy aims to minimize disruption within the cryptocurrency ecosystem while ensuring robust protection against future quantum threats.
